  • The purpose of this study is to investigate the influence of corporate social responsibility (CSR) disclosure towards the company’s financial performance. Corporate social responsibility (CSR) is company’s activities in achieving a balance or integrations between the economic, social and environment development without compromising the expectations of shareholder (obtain profit). In this research, company’s financial performance measured by financial ratio, consist of liquidity ratio with Current Ratio (CR) indicator, profitability ratio with Return On Asset (ROA) indicator and activity ratio with Asset Turnover (ATO) indicator. From the third variables was done factor analysis that produce a new dependent variable namely financial performance. The populations used in this study are the companies that included on LQ45 index in Indonesia Stock Exchange at 2009 - 2012. The samples was got by using purposive sampling method. There are 20 companies that meet the criteria of the study sample. The analysis method used is simple regression. Data collection method used in this research is documentation method. Based on test results, the first hypothesis found that the variable corporate social responsibility (CSR) disclosure has not significant effect on Current Ratio (CR). While the second hypothesis found that corporate social responsibility (CSR) disclosure variables has not significant effect on Return On Asset (ROA). The third hyphotesis found that corporate social responsibility (CSR) disclosure has not significant effect on Asset Turnover (ATO). So, the fourth hyphotesis also found that of corporate social responsibility (CSR) disclosure has not significant effect on company’s financial performance.
